  1. The custom was that a feast was held on the Wedding day night and all the friends and neigbours were invited. The straw boys visited the house that the people would get married in. The straw boys wore a straw hat and a belt of straw around their middle. There was one boy dressed like a girl. He wears a girls dress and hat on him. Then the straw boys would dance and the people would give them drink. All horses that was long ago and every man and woman use to go on one horse
